ورود

View Full Version : سوال: پایگاه داده برای وبسایت



likemoon
جمعه 17 دی 1389, 18:27 عصر
سلام
من دارم یه پایگاه داده برای یه وبسایت یه شرکت بیمه ای طراحی میکنم .بعد میخوام این امکان رو داشته باشه که تمام فرمهایی رو که شخص بیمه گذار میخواد بره تو دفتر بیمه و به صورت حضوری پر کنه بتونه با مراجعه به وبسایت و به صورت آنلاین پر کنه.
حالا فرمها رو توی ویژوال استودیو طراحی کردم مونده بخش پایگاه داده.مشکل من اینه که کلآ گیج شدم و نمیدونم جدول ها رو به چه صورت طراحی بکنم چون این فرمها یک سری مشخصات مشترک دارن مثل نام و مشخصات بیمه گذار و آدرس و فلان که تو همشون مشترک هست و یه سری دیگه از مشخصات که خاص فرم مربوط به خودش هست (مثلا فرم بیمه آتش سوزی ،بیمه عمر،بیمه خودرو و ...) میخوام بدونم باید یه دیتا بیس بسازم و به تعداد فرمها جدول داشته باشم و به تعداد آیتمهای مشخصاتشون ستون؟ یا اینکه راه دیگه ایی هست که مثلا مشخصات تکراری دیگه نخوان تو هر جدول تکرار بشن.
اینم بگم که این پروژه پایان نامم هست و اولین کارمه لطفآ راهنمایی کنید

اگه لازمه بگید تا من یکی دو نمونه از فرمها رو اسکن کنم بزارم تا سوالم روشن تر بشه

L u k e
جمعه 17 دی 1389, 18:51 عصر
من یه همچین برنامه ای درست کردم آره با اینکه بیشتر خصوصیات بیمه ها شبیه به همه ولی بهتره جدول اش رو جدا از هم بسازی چون ممکنه در آینده بخوان فیلدی اضافه کنن و یه سری شخصی سازی ها واسه بیمه ها به وجود بیاد
پس فیلد Type و این جور چیزا رو بیخیال شو

likemoon
جمعه 17 دی 1389, 20:42 عصر
ممنون جناب luke
یه سوال دیگه میخوام به هر کسی که فرم رو پر میکنه یه کد انحصاری برای پیگیری کارهاش تخصص داده بشه چکار باید بکنم؟

حمیدرضاصادقیان
شنبه 18 دی 1389, 11:34 صبح
سلام.
دوست عزیز شما ابتدا باید دیتابیس رو طراحی کنید بعد برید سروقت طراحی برنامه.
اول شما باید کامل صورت مسئله رو بنویسید.
جزئیات رو یادداشت کنید.
مشخص کنید چه اطلاعاتی تکراری هستند، چه اطلاعاتی به هم وابستگی دارند، نوع اطلاعاتی که قرار در هر فیلد ذخیره بشه چی هست؟
به چه نوعی میخواهید اطلاعات رو از دیتابیس بخونید یا بنویسید.
بعد تازه برید سروقت طراحی دیتابیس.
تاوقتی کلیات و جزئیات کار کاملا مشخص نشه نمیتونید دیتابیس درستی طراحی کنید.